1. Building an Effective Supplement Stack for Nutritional Supplements
A supplement stack is a deliberate combination of products taken together to support defined goals, chosen and dosed to minimize redundancy and maximize complementarity. It matters because layering “good” products haphazardly can lead to excessive overlap, ineffective timing, or nutrient imbalances that dilute results. Begin by mapping your objectives (for example, maintain energy, support immune function, improve sleep, manage training stress) and get baseline data where feasible—dietary intake, relevant biomarkers, and a sense of your lifestyle constraints. Core principles include customization (select for your physiology and goals), balance (avoid megadoses unless medically indicated), and scientific backing (prioritize ingredients with reproducible evidence and established safety). Assess diet quality and exposure: low oily‑fish intake often warrants omega‑3 support; limited sun exposure commonly correlates with lower vitamin D status; high training loads may increase magnesium needs. Choose compatible supplements to promote synergy rather than redundancy—think vitamin D supported by magnesium, or vitamin C complementing iron intake when warranted. For general wellness, a pragmatic stack might include vitamin D (per guidance based on status), magnesium (for normal muscle function and energy‑yielding metabolism), an omega‑3 providing EPA and DHA, and targeted add‑ons like vitamin C for antioxidant support and collagen formation. For muscle building, layer sufficient protein intake, creatine monohydrate, and perhaps caffeine timed around training paired with L‑theanine for focus, while maintaining foundational micronutrients. For aging support, emphasize vitamin D, vitamin K, omega‑3s, magnesium, and possibly choline or lutein from diet or supplements—always aligned with safety guidance. Avoid pitfalls: chasing novelty over fundamentals, stacking multiple products with the same nutrients, ignoring interactions (for example, calcium with iron), or skipping dietary anchors like fiber, protein, and polyphenol‑rich plants. Finally, source quality products with transparent labeling and third‑party testing, and match forms to your tolerance and needs.
2. Crafting an Effective Supplement Regimen to Support Your Nutritional Goals
Consistency turns a theoretically sound stack into real‑world benefits, and that starts with a routine that fits how you live, eat, train, and sleep. Build your regimen around meals and recurring anchors—breakfast, pre‑training, dinner—to simplify adherence and to enhance absorption where appropriate. Prioritize core supplements that address common gaps and have durable evidence supporting their roles: vitamin D contributes to the maintenance of normal bones and supports normal immune function; magnesium contributes to normal muscle function and reduction of tiredness and fatigue; omega‑3s with EPA and DHA contribute to the normal function of the heart, and DHA contributes to the maintenance of normal brain function and vision; vitamin C contributes to the protection of cells from oxidative stress and normal collagen formation. Time fat‑soluble vitamins with meals containing healthy fats, and schedule others by mechanism and tolerance: caffeine earlier in the day, probiotics away from antibacterial mouthwashes and sometimes taken on an empty stomach as tolerated, iron away from calcium. Adjust your plan based on regular check‑ins: Are you noticing improved sleep quality, steadier energy, fewer training slumps, or clearer recovery markers? If not, simplify or retime before adding more. Avoid over‑supplementation by tracking total daily intakes across multivitamins and single‑ingredient products, respecting established upper levels, and discontinuing compounds that don’t show a clear role. Safety also means pausing certain supplements before procedures when advised, checking medication interactions (particularly with vitamin K and anticoagulants), and consulting a professional when adding higher‑dose or goal‑specific agents. The goal is a regimen that is simple enough to follow every day, precise enough to move your metrics, and flexible enough to evolve with your nutrition and training.
3. Pairing Nutrition with Supplements for Optimal Absorption and Efficacy
Food meaningfully alters supplement bioavailability and tolerance, so pairing matters as much as what you take. Fat‑soluble vitamins such as A, D, E, and K are better absorbed alongside dietary fats; a meal with olive oil, eggs, nuts, or salmon can support uptake. Water‑soluble vitamins like vitamin C are generally food‑flexible, but taking them with meals can improve tolerance and align with collagen‑rich or polyphenol‑rich foods that complement their roles. Certain minerals require special attention: non‑heme iron absorption increases with vitamin C and is reduced by calcium and some polyphenols, so take iron away from dairy and strong tea or coffee and alongside a vitamin C‑containing food when appropriate. Probiotics often perform best away from very hot beverages and sometimes on an empty stomach, while prebiotics (fiber from foods like legumes, oats, onions, and bananas) nourish beneficial microbes and may potentiate probiotic effects over time. Whole foods also smooth the peaks and troughs of stimulants: pairing caffeine with protein and complex carbohydrates can stabilize energy and reduce jitters, while co‑ingesting L‑theanine softens overstimulation without blunting alertness. Be mindful of interactions that reduce effectiveness: high‑dose zinc can interfere with copper status; very high calcium intakes can compete with iron and magnesium; and excessive alcohol undermines nutrient absorption and recovery. Practical strategies include: dedicate one main meal to fat‑soluble vitamins; schedule iron or specialized compounds mid‑morning or mid‑afternoon; take magnesium glycinate or citrate in the evening if it fits your tolerance and sleep routine; and keep hydration and sodium‑potassium balance in mind for athletes. Framing supplements as meal accents—rather than random add‑ons—lets you turn each plate into a delivery platform that enhances absorption, reduces stomach upset, and works in harmony with the microbiome’s needs.
4. Leveraging Supplement Synergy for Enhanced Results
Synergy means using combinations that reinforce each other’s roles, helping you do more with fewer pills and lower doses. A classic example is vitamin D and magnesium: magnesium participates in vitamin D metabolism, and adequate magnesium intake helps support the maintenance of normal bones and muscles, making this a rational pairing. Another is vitamin D with vitamin K for bone health; vitamin K contributes to the maintenance of normal bones and normal blood clotting, complementing vitamin D’s role. Vitamin C and iron provide a food‑plus‑supplement synergy by enhancing non‑heme iron absorption when taken together, useful for those with lower iron intake from plant‑forward diets and under suitable guidance. For cognitive performance, caffeine with L‑theanine can improve focus and smooth the “edge,” beneficial for study, creative work, or pre‑training routines sensitive to overstimulation. Athletes may combine creatine with carbohydrates to leverage insulin‑mediated uptake into muscle, while keeping hydration and electrolyte balance aligned with training volume. For joint, tendon, or bone support, consider collagen or gelatin with vitamin C around activity that loads connective tissue, alongside adequate protein across the day; add minerals like magnesium and maintain vitamin D and K sufficiency for structural support. Omega‑3s (EPA and DHA) can complement a diet low in oily fish, with evidence supporting roles in normal heart function; coupling omega‑3 intake with meals and choline‑rich foods (for example, eggs) integrates lipid metabolism and membrane support. Recognize and avoid negative interactions: very high‑dose zinc may compromise copper status, megadoses of fat‑soluble vitamins can accumulate, and vitamin K interacts with certain anticoagulant medications—medical advice is essential when relevant. Designing combinations starts with essentials, adds one or two synergies tied to your goals, and resists the urge to stack many overlapping antioxidants or stimulants, which can crowd out foundations and complicate feedback.
5. Implementing Dosing Strategies for Maximum Impact and Safety
Effective dosing sits at the intersection of evidence, individual needs, and safety frameworks that set tolerable upper levels for nutrients. Begin with label‑directed serving sizes from reputable brands and evaluate whether they cover realistic gaps given your diet and status; for example, someone living at high latitude with limited sun may need vitamin D support in line with guidance, ideally informed by status testing and professional input. Body size, age, activity level, and training load can all modify practical dosing ranges for certain nutrients within safe boundaries—athletes with heavy sweat losses may emphasize electrolytes and magnesium more than sedentary peers. Cycling and periodization help preserve sensitivity and minimize tolerance: take regular caffeine breaks or cap daily intake on non‑training days; rotate nootropics or adaptogens rather than running multiple agents continuously; use targeted “blocks” for goal‑specific supplements (for example, collagen timed around tendon rehab or increased loading cycles). Monitor subjective and objective responses: energy stability, sleep quality, perceived recovery, training performance, and simple biomarkers where appropriate. Recognize red flags of overdoing it: persistent gastrointestinal distress after mineral megadoses, restlessness from excessive stimulants, unusually vivid flushing from high niacin forms, or signs of imbalance like unexplained fatigue when stacking multiple zinc‑rich products. Use a supplement log to track date started, dose, timing, co‑ingestion, and notes; make one change at a time to attribute effects clearly. Safety anchors include reading interactions sections carefully, pausing or modifying supplements around surgeries as directed, and consulting qualified healthcare professionals for personalized guidance—especially for pregnancy, chronic conditions, or medications. The aim is to hit the minimum effective dose that delivers your outcome, stay within established safety margins, and rely on diet and lifestyle to do the heavy lifting.
